Where will BFR be built?

Re: Where will BFR be built?
05/07/2018 02:49 pm
I split the thread where I saw the first mention of the documentation for the new manufacturing facility in San Pedro.  New thread is: BFR Manufacturing Facility in San Pedro (Los Angeles)


